Properties of Polylactic Acid Fiber based Polymers and their Correlation with Composition
Biodegradable corn polylactic acid fiber (PLA), cotton and lycra with different weight ratio were synthesized. In order to understand the relation between the properties and the blended ratio of the fabric, 5 kinds of blended fabrics are choose and tested by various equipments. By the analysis of the thermal-moisture transmission properties and the air permeability, the optimum blended ratio of the PLA/cotton/lycra blended fabric is determined. The properties of the blended fabric could be adjusted by changing the compositions. The new fabrics are expected to have potential uses biomedicine materials.
